How to verify the connection of the Deggy Control ports

This article explains how to check if the TCP ports required for Deggy Control operation are open or closed. 

Deggy Control needs outbound TCP ports 9090 and 49150 open to deggywebai.com 
  1. 1

    Turn on Telnet Client

    1. Press the Windows key and type "Windows features" in the search bar. Then, select Turn Windows features on or off

    2. Tick the Telnet Client checkbox and click OK

  2. 2

    Check the Ports

    1. Press the Windows key + R, then type "cmd.exe" and click OK

    2. Enter "telnet deggywebai.com 9090" to run the telnet command in Command Prompt and test the TCP port status.

    3. If the port is open, only a cursor will show:

      If the port is closed, a message will say Connect failed

    4. Repeat step b to the port 49150: "telnet deggywebai.com 49150"
